Omar El Chmouri / Bloomberg : Sources: Riyadh-based AI startup Humain is planning to raise an initial $2.5B fund to help finance data center capacity of 250 MW in Saudi Arabia — Artificial intelligence firm Humain is planning to raise an initial $2.5 billion from global and domestic investors for a fund to invest …
